Qatar Tourism is on the lookout for an experienced sales executive with an exceptional track record in managing travel agency groups and delivering results, to manage relationships with Visit Qatar’s trade and promotional partners in key markets.
The successful candidate will develop a successful, consistent and commercially prudent approach to market activity to drive maximum visitation in the promotion of Qatar as a tourism destination for Australian and New Zealand travellers.
Working closely with Qatar Airways and Discover Qatar on joint promotional and sales activities, developing and executing strategic account plans, and representing Visit Qatar at trade and promotional events.

Your responsibilities will include:
- Develops and maintains long-term strategic relationships with Visit Qatar partners.
- Target focus on key Travel agency, tour operators/ OTA’s to increase Qatar product placement and drive adoption of the Qatar Stopover Program via target-based marketing/ partnership agreements.
- Prepare an account development plan to achieve short, medium- and long-term mutual benefits for trade and promotional partners.
- Prepare internal proposals which clearly articulate the opportunity and ROI for projects and initiatives which promote Qatar in the market.
- Complete & execute key account activity plans and initiatives to promote Qatar and drive visitation to Qatar with the support of Regional Manager and Doha based Coordinators.
- Partner with the Qatar Airways and Discover Qatar sales team to promote the Qatar Stopover Program and Qatar as a tourism destination.
- Provide training to partners so that they can confidently sell and promote Qatar.
- Coordinate and attend trade shows, workshops and fam trips.
- Coordinate trade marketing to promote Qatar across the trade media channels.
- Collaborate with VQ stakeholders – Qatar Airways, Hotels, Discover Qatar, Other DMC’s, and Qatar Attractions
- Generate monthly sales reports and continually communicate with Melbourne based Regional Market Manager to agree priorities, highlight successes and blockers.
- Destination training to the travel trade and increase Qatar Specialist Program (online training and travel trade engagement platform) subscriptions and interactions.
- Look for opportunities for strategic alliances in MICE, Leisure and Business travel verticals.
- Perform other department duties related to his/ her position as directed by Head of the Department.
